Role Overview

The Problem Manager is responsible for identifying, analyzing, and eliminating the root causes of incidents to improve overall service stability. The role ensures that problems are proactively detected, RCA is performed effectively, and corrective measures are implemented to prevent recurrence.

 

Key Responsibilities

  • Proactively identify and analyze problems through incident trend analysis.
  • Conduct detailed Root Cause Analysis (RCA) using methodologies such as 5 Whys, Fishbone, and KT.
  • Create and manage Problem Records and Known Errors as per ITIL framework.
  • Track progress of problem tickets (Known Errors, Workarounds, PIRs).
  • Drive permanent fixes and preventive actions with technical teams.
  • Maintain and improve the Problem Management process, policies, and KPIs.  
  • Ensure problems are logged, updated, and closed within agreed timelines.
  • Facilitate Post-Incident Review (PIR) meetings for major incidents.
  • Maintain and enhance the Problem Management Process and associated documentation.
  • Work closely with Incident, Change, Application, and Infrastructure teams.
  • Facilitate RCA workshops and ensure all participants contribute effectively.  
  • Provide regular reports to management on trends, risks, and improvements.
  • Ensure timely updates and communication to stakeholders and leadership.
  • Create dashboards and reports on recurring incidents, RCA status, and problem trends.
  • Recommend service improvements and optimization opportunities.  
  • Analyze process gaps and propose enhancements.
  • Maintain all problem records, known error database (KEDB), and workarounds.  
  • Convert RCAs into actionable knowledge articles for operational teams.

Key KPIs / Success Metrics

  • Reduction in recurring incidents.
  • Timely closure of Problem Records.
  • Quality and completeness of RCA reports.
  • Compliance with ITIL processes.
  • Stakeholder satisfaction.
